Instigation Editing

As a Regulator you will monitor the incoming Instigations and mark them for approval. It is up to you to decide several important factors about the Instigation that will be key in the overall "smooth" operation of the Instigation move process.

Upon logging in as a Regulator, you will be taken to the "Manage Instigation" page:

The panel on the left contains all those Instigations that require your attention. For each Instigation selected, it's details will appear in the panel on the right.

Right now, let's concentrate on the Details pane.

Each of the parameters that can be modified are indicated with TheObjectIs.com's unique "Graphical Data Modification Button" or GDBM.

The GDBM has several important characteristics about it, as follows:

Right now, the graphic is blue, meaning that data cannot be edited.

Once clicked, however, the graphic will change to green and the control that contains the data is enabled for data modification.

It is important to note that if a button is placed into a disabled state; any data modifications that were made before it became disabled will also be lost.

When all data modifications have been complete, you should see all the buttons with modifications made to them containing green graphics.

Then hit the "Update" button and your changes are posted back to the database.

The "Drivers" tab allows you to assign drivers to the Instigation as necessary.

You can use the <SHIFT> key with the mouse to select a range of items or the <CTRL> key to select multiple items, clicking one after the other

By clicking "Update" any changes are reflected in the "Drivers Details" grid as explained below.

To help facilitate in the choice of drivers, a "Drivers Details" grid shows the number of moves already assigned to a driver and the total amount of time consumed by assignment to those moves. Furthermore, a sub-details grid shows Instigations to which he has been assigned.
